ENGW vs SLW Match Preview

The England women's team is doing a good job in the T20 international games. They succeeded in reaching the semifinals of the T20 World Cup and also won the recently concluded T20I series against Australia by a close margin of 2-1. The England selectors have named a full squad for their series against Sri Lankan women. We will get to see some new faces in this game such as the speedster Mahika Gaur and wicketkeeper batswoman Bess Heath. The key players with the bat for England women are Danielle Wyatt, Alice Capsey, and Heather Knight.

Danielle Wyatt is going into this game after a remarkable performance in the recently played Hundred competition for women. She has collected 2478 runs from 146 runs for the British. Knight has also done well for England having scored over 1600 runs. Alice Capsey is relatively a newcomer for England women but she has established herself as a big hitter in the team. The best bowlers in the team will be Danielle Wyatt, Issy Wong, and Sarah Glenn. Wyatt and Glenn have picked up 46 and 59 scalps respectively for England. Another good bowler in the team is Wong who has established her credentials as the best spinner in the team.

After the completion of the T20I world, Sri Lankan women have played a couple of series against viz. Bangladesh and New Zealand. Lankans succeeded in defeating Bangladesh by a margin of 2-1 and they lost to the Kiwi women by the same margin. The best batter for Sri Lankan women is Chamari Atapaththu. She will need to do well for Sri Lankan women to harbor any hopes of beating England in this series. She has amassed as many as 2484 runs for Lanka. Nilakshi de Silva has also done well for her country scoring over 800 runs in the process.

There will be a lot of expectations from Harshita Madavi as well who has the reputation of being a clean hitter of the cricket ball. The onus in the bowling department for Sri Lanka will be with Inoka Ranaweera, Kavisha Dilhari, and Oshadi Ranansinghe. These bowlers have picked up 81, 21, and 58 wickets respectively for their country. The Sri Lankan women played their last T20 international series against New Zealand. They had to endure a close 2-1 defeat in this series played at home.

Pitch Report

This first match of the T20I series will be hosted at the County Ground in Hove. The English women have an atrocious record at this venue. They have lost 6 out of the 7 matches they have played here. The pitch on offer here will be a good one for batting and the seamers can get some help from the track.
